Mozilla company history timeline

2005

The Mozilla Corporation was established in August 2005 as a wholly owned taxable subsidiary that serves the non-profit, public benefit goals of its parent, the Mozilla Foundation, and the vast Mozilla community.

October, 2005 - Firefox surpasses 100 million downloads

2006

February, 2006 - Firefox download site launched at Yahoo! Japan

2008

In June 2008 Firefox 3.0 included a new Web page-rendering engine to improve performance.

2009

Cumulative downloads for the Firefox browser exceeded one billion on July 31, 2009, making it easily the most widely used open-source software in the world.

2010

In 2010 Firefox surpassed Internet Explorer to become the most popular Web browser in Europe—the first time Internet Explorer was not the most-used browser in a major market area.

2011

As of the year 2011, the total revenue generated by the company was $163 million.

2013

Mozilla also celebrated its 15th anniversary in 2013.

2017

As of the year 2017, the company has rebranded its logo from the dinosaur symbol to 'moz://a'. The headquarters of the company is based in 331 East Evelyn Avenue.

2021

As of 2021, Firefox was the fourth most popular browser worldwide, with 3.9 percent of the market, after Chrome (64 percent), Apple’s Safari (19 percent), and Microsoft’s Edge (4.2 percent).
